android指定wifi連接
① Android WiFi連接手機
Android通過WiFi連接手機,擺脫線的束縛,並且手機不需要root。
首先,確認電腦沒有任何其它adb設備連接,包括模擬器。
1、手機與電腦在同一個WiFi網路
2、手機與電腦用USB連接線先連接
3、終端輸入命令:adb tcpip 5555。確認輸出:restarting in TCP mode:5555
4、終端輸入命令:adb connect 手機IP:5555。確認輸出:connected to 手機IP:5555
5、拔出USB連接線,此時可以查看LogCat設備選項卡中已有連接的設備。
OK!現在可以擺脫usb數據線的束縛,可以愉快的玩耍了。
AndroidStudio插件: https://zhuanlan.hu.com/p/65406343
推薦:ADB WiFi Connect 和 WIFI ADB ULITIMATE
② android 給我一段代碼,點擊一個按鈕,手機就連上指定的wifi
public class HotspotActivity extends Activity {
private WifiManager wifiManager;
private Button open;
private boolean flag=false;
@Override
protected void onCreate(Bundle savedInstanceState) {
// TODO Auto-generated method stub
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
//獲取wifi管理服務
wifiManager = (WifiManager) getSystemService(Context.WIFI_SERVICE);
open=(Button)findViewById(R.id.open_hotspot);
//通過按鈕事件設置熱點
open.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
//如果是打開狀態就關閉,如果是關閉就打開
flag=!flag;
setWifiApEnabled(flag);
}
});
}
// wifi熱點開關
public boolean setWifiApEnabled(boolean enabled) {
if (enabled) { // disable WiFi in any case
//wifi和熱點不能同時打開,所以打開熱點的時候需要關閉wifi
wifiManager.setWifiEnabled(false);
}
try {
//熱點的配置類
WifiConfiguration apConfig = new WifiConfiguration();
//配置熱點的名稱(可以在名字後面加點隨機數什麼的)
apConfig.SSID = "YRCCONNECTION";
//配置熱點的密碼
apConfig.preSharedKey="12122112";
//通過反射調用設置熱點
Method method = wifiManager.getClass().getMethod(
"setWifiApEnabled", WifiConfiguration.class, Boolean.TYPE);
//返回熱點打開狀態
return (Boolean) method.invoke(wifiManager, apConfig, enabled);
} catch (Exception e) {
return false;
}
}
}
在人家網易博客上看到的
博主:bsky
③ android如何控制只能連接固定的wifi
方法步驟:
一、依次點擊「設定」>「WLAN」
④ 安卓手機怎麼用wifi無線上網
尊敬的電信用戶,您好!
安卓手機連接wifi:點擊手機正面的主菜單鍵,設置—無線區域網—啟動,即可。
感謝關注電信,祝你愉快。
⑤ android wifi 開發中 如何判斷成功連接上了指定的wifi熱點
首先通過WifiManager對象獲取系統服務的WIFI_SERVICE,然後調用getConnectionInfo()獲得WifiInfo對象,再通過WifiInfo對象獲取已連上wifi的SSID(實際上是housyunhin說的WifiInfo.getSSID()和其他wifi信息),之後判斷是否匹配即可
⑥ Android Wifi 如何實現:在程序中把SSID和密碼都確定了,點擊連接就連接上指定的wifi
點擊打開設定,
點擊WLAN連接,
點擊添加WLAN。